Breaking Down the Features of BURRIS XTB-SAVAGE STEEL BASE SA

Specifications

  • The BURRIS XTB-SAVAGE STEEL BASE SA is a one-piece base designed for Savage short action rifles with a round rear receiver. This ensures a secure and stable mounting platform, crucial for maintaining accuracy.
  • It’s constructed from steel, providing exceptional durability and resistance to recoil. Steel is significantly stronger than aluminum, preventing flexing or shifting under heavy use.
  • The base is compatible with both Weaver-style and Picatinny-style rings, offering maximum versatility. This allows users to choose from a wide range of scope mounting options.
  • It features a matte finish, which helps to reduce glare and reflection. A matte finish is ideal for hunting and tactical applications, preventing unwanted attention.
  • This particular model lacks a cantilever, keeping the scope closer to the bore axis. This can improve accuracy, particularly at longer ranges.

Performance & Functionality

The BURRIS XTB-SAVAGE STEEL BASE SA excels at providing a rock-solid platform for mounting optics. It eliminates any play or movement, ensuring consistent zero retention even with heavy recoil rifles. The base performs exactly as intended: it securely holds the scope in place, allowing the shooter to focus on accuracy.

The main strength of this base is its exceptional stability and durability. A potential weakness could be its lack of integrated MOA (Minute of Angle) elevation, requiring shimming or adjustable rings for long-range shooting with certain scopes. Who Should Buy BURRIS XTB-SAVAGE STEEL BASE SA?

This base is perfect for hunters and target shooters who demand unwavering accuracy from their Savage short action rifles. Anyone who needs a reliable and durable mounting platform will benefit from the BURRIS XTB-SAVAGE STEEL BASE SA.

This product is not ideal for shooters who prioritize lightweight setups or need built-in elevation adjustments for extreme long-range shooting. These shooters may want to consider bases with integrated MOA adjustments or opt for a lightweight aluminum option, sacrificing some durability.

A must-have accessory would be a set of high-quality steel rings to match the durability of the base. A torque wrench is also recommended to ensure proper installation and prevent damage to the receiver.
